Output af8fa2990eb116d0cfcdf73e02cef34140a70f17683ea9bdcbd34fcc1e5ffcaa:0

value
70509
script pubkey
OP_0 OP_PUSHBYTES_20 664b7e6b367d8d42e3aff5941b8313ebb9e1eed2
address
bc1qve9hu6ek0kx59ca07k2phqcnawu7rmkjntf4y7
transaction
af8fa2990eb116d0cfcdf73e02cef34140a70f17683ea9bdcbd34fcc1e5ffcaa
confirmations
117352
spent
true